Output 29678628cb7cc86ede00505b8c7ed9e72db04a9931f788c0a30af9c884540557:0

value
6838341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2196579054daa13e58a81596e8e9545f684416b OP_EQUALVERIFY OP_CHECKSIG
address
1HEhhibGr4CMRHYRSx7BwMMi2Gux8PL3PB
transaction
29678628cb7cc86ede00505b8c7ed9e72db04a9931f788c0a30af9c884540557
spent
true